Creatine is having a moment — it's in gummies, powders, capsules, and about half the ads in your feed. So Rick and Greg sat down to sort out what's real. In this episode they explain what creatine actually does at the cellular level (it recharges the ATP "battery pack" your muscles burn through in the first seconds of any effort), and why that matters more than the marketing suggests. The honest version: creatine doesn't build muscle. It gives you the energy to do two more reps or run one more mile — and that's what builds muscle. They cover realistic dosing at three to five grams a day, why timing matters far less than consistency, the water weight you might see early on, and the newer research pointing toward brain and cognitive benefits at higher doses. They also tackle the kidney myth head-on, explaining the lab-value mix-up between creatine and creatinine that sends so many patients into an unnecessary panic — and why you should simply tell your provider you're taking it. Plus: who benefits most (vegetarians, older adults, and anyone actively losing weight on a GLP-1), who should check with a clinician first, and the buying advice that'll save you money — plain creatine monohydrate from a reputable brand is what every study used, and there's no such thing as men's or women's creatine.
